WebMar 2, 2024 · The characteristics of S waves are: They come after the Primary Waves during an earthquake. They cause shear on the Earth’s surface. These waves move at a velocity that is almost half of that of the P-Waves. These waves can only move through a solid medium. The S waves are stopped by liquid layers or structures. WebUnlike P waves, S waves cannot travel through the molten outer core of the Earth, and this causes a shadow zone for S waves opposite to their origin. They can still propagate through the solid inner core: when a P wave strikes the boundary of molten and solid cores at an oblique angle, S waves will form and propagate in the solid medium. slbk11_missionrow fivemWebS Waves.
